This week’s header photo There was plenty of nervous energy on Friday as our Year 7 students began their secondary education at Bayview College. Corey Herbertson was lucky to have his older sister Sheridan guiding him on his first day. More photos on page 4 …………………………………………. A reminder that all students must wear the approved Bayview Bucket hat in Term 1 & 4. They are available for purchase at reception.
